About the Role

We are hiring a UX Designer who sits at the intersection of design and engineering. The research and judgment that define strong UX work remain at the center of this role - what changes is the toolkit. Rather than producing static design files as the primary output, you will build functioning prototypes and, where appropriate, functioning front-end code, using AI-assisted development tools to move quickly from user insight to a testable, interactive result. The person who understands the user need is the same person putting it into a form that can be tested and refined.

This role works closely with Technical Product Managers and engineers across one of our full-stack product teams, with real ownership over the end-to-end experience - from early research through to a working result that preserves design intent. If you are energized by complex, data-rich products and want your work to have a tangible impact on how organizations manage energy and sustainability, this is the role for you.

What You'll Do

  • Conduct customer and internal user research - interviews, surveys, usability testing - and synthesize findings into a clear understanding of user needs, motivations, and friction points that directly inform product direction.
  • Validate that the product is delivering the outcomes customers actually want and carry that evidence into product decisions alongside Technical Product Managers and engineers.
  • Build functioning prototypes in code rather than static mockups, so that ideas can be tested in something close to the real experience - using AI-assisted development tools such as Claude Code to move from insight to a testable build quickly.
  • Produce functioning front-end code where it is the right path to a working result, with a clear handoff point where your output is reviewed by engineering before it reaches production.
  • Define interaction patterns, hierarchy, and visual design directly in the medium customers will use, and iterate based on what testing reveals - holding the standard for accessibility and quality throughout.
  • Collaborate with Technical Product Managers and engineers to align prototypes and builds with technical constraints, product goals, and business outcomes.
  • Contribute to key AI-powered product initiatives, including Bill Capture tooling that extracts and processes utility data, and the Watts AI agent experience.
